Sena Madureira vs La Serena-La Florida Climate & Distance Between

Chile flag
  • The distance between Sena Madureira, Brazil and La Serena-La Florida, Chile is approximately 2,326 km or 1,445 mi.
  • To reach Sena Madureira in this distance one would set out from La Serena-La Florida bearing 7°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Sena Madureira bearing 6.2° or N .
  • Sena Madureira has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as La Serena-La Florida has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Sena Madureira is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as La Serena-La Florida is in or near the cool temperate desert biome.
  • The average temperature is 11.1 °C (19.9°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.4 °C (6.1°F) less in Sena Madureira.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2059.5 mm (81.1 in) more which is equivalent to 2059.5 l/m² (50.55 US gal/ft²) or 20,595,000 l/ha (2,201,742 US gal/ac) more. About 27 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.8° higher in Sena Madureira than in La Serena-La Florida.
